**Runbook: Nightly search reindex (Lanternquill)**

The reindex job kicks off at 02:15 and rebuilds the Lanternquill search index from the primary document store. Normal runtime is 40–55 minutes. If it exceeds 90 minutes, check the extractor pods for memory pressure before restarting anything — a mid-run restart leaves a partial index that must be manually discarded. Queries keep serving from the previous index until the swap completes, so there is no user-facing urgency. The recovery procedure is documented on the page below.

operations page: https://jenkins.zemvarcloud.local/job/merge_requests/repo/build/73930b4b30f0a8ed

## Runbook: EventSpine Schema Registry — Release Step 4

Before promoting a new registry build to production, confirm that all schema compatibility checks in the Larkmoor staging cluster have passed twice consecutively. Tag the build with the release train identifier, then freeze the subject list so no producers register mid-deploy. Future maintainers: never skip the freeze; silent schema drift caused the Q3 incident. Once the frozen snapshot is verified, the bundle must be signed before upload. Use the key below.

rollout seal: bky4_x7Gc

## Tuning the FD hunt

Welcome aboard! The Burrowscope leak hunter samples open file descriptors across Tindale services and flags handles that outlive their owning request. It's noisy out of the box — most "leaks" are just long polls — so you'll want to tighten the age threshold and sampling rate before trusting the reports.

Start conservative, then ratchet down until the false-positive channel quiets. Everything lives in one config block. These are the constants we currently run in staging:

tuning table, yajog-yahof:
BUDGETS = {
    "lamvan": 303,
    "wenox": 460,
    "fenvan": 525,
}

Welcome aboard! As release manager for GateTally, you own the turnstile counter deploys at Marrowfield Stadium. The counters sync attendance data every 90 seconds to the Hullcrest backend, and a bad release means the ops crew goes blind on crowd flow — so always stage on the practice-gate cluster first. Releases are gated by Priya-from-infra's checklist, which lives in the GateTally wiki. One last thing: to unlock the release vault on your first deploy, you'll need the recovery passphrase below.

strongbox words: gilok-druion-briath-wendor-briion-prawyn-fenion-oliir-casdor-holius-briius-gilath-gilael-pelys